Portea Medical has acquired majority stake in healthcare tech startup PSTakeCare in an all-cash deal. The details of the deal has not been disclosed.
PSTakeCare provides information on doctors, hospitals and other healthcare service providers based on factors such as insurance coverage provided, procedure-specific feedback and room-wise costs and helps consumers take better decisions.
PSTakeCare owned by Takecare Technology, was founded in March 2015 by Pratik Chinchole, Rahil Momin, Anup Raaj and Shirin Shinde.
Mumbai based PSTakeCare now plans to expand and launch services in other metros.
Portea claims to handle more than 70,000 visits to patients’ homes in a month. It is present across 24 cities in India and has more than 4,000 staff. The company also has a presence in Malaysia. Portea had earlier acquired Medybiz Pharma.
